Pana Pesca Lightly Breaded Squid/Calamari Ring and Tentacle
Breaded Squid/Calamari Ring and Tentacle
- Premium quality Japanese flying squid
- Lightly dusted to perform like hand-breaded calamari
- IQF to preserve freshness
- Fry and serve
- Fully cleaned
- Wild-caught
- Keep frozen for later use
- 4 oz. (113.39 g) each
- 40 packs per case
The Pana Pesca Lightly Breaded Raw Squid/Calamari Ring and Tentacle comes fully cleaned and ready to fry. These squid rings and tentacles are available in portion packs and can be deep-fried in about one minute. The bulk pack of Pana Pesca Lightly Breaded Raw Squid/Calamari Ring and Tentacle is suited for snack bars, delis, and seafood restaurants.
